Kettering Train Station is well-equipped to meet the needs of its passengers. The ticket office is open from 6:00 a.m. to 8:30 p.m. on weekdays, with similar hours over the weekend. For those who prefer self-service, ticket machines are readily available and accessible, and there's even the option to collect tickets bought online. Ensuring a smooth travel experience for everyone, the station boasts step-free access and a multitude of accessible features, including tactile paving and induction loops.
Passengers can appreciate the cozy waiting areas available daily, complemented by accessible seating and heated rooms. For those needing additional support, customer help points and staff assistance are available throughout the station. You'll also find essentials such as toilets, baby-changing facilities, and a selection of refreshments for a pleasant travel experience.

St Andrews Road station is a simple setup with limited facilities. There isn't a ticket office or ticket machines, so passengers need to plan ahead and purchase tickets online or at another station. However, an induction loop is available for those with hearing aids, ensuring essential announcements are accessible.
Although staff assistance isn't on hand at all times, customer help points are scattered throughout the station for travelers needing information or support. Unfortunately, luggage storage, lost property, and CCTV surveillance are services absent at this station.
For accessible facilities, St Andrews Road station leaves much to be desired. There's a lack of step-free access, accessible toilets, and ramps for train access. This could pose challenges for passengers with reduced mobility, although seating areas are present should you need a break while waiting.
Traveling onward from St Andrews Road is a breeze thanks to its bus services. There are bus stops conveniently located on either side of the road near the station. Although taxis and car hire services are not directly available at the station, arriving by bike is always an option with bicycle stands on site.
